The Department of Pediatrics Academic Affairs Office provides guidance for and oversees the processes of assigning academic rank for new hires, mid-point reviews for assistant professors, academic promotion, and awards of tenure.
Nancy Krebs, MD, MS, serves as Associate Vice Chair for Academic Affairs and Mark Abzug, MD, serves as Vice Chair for Academic Affairs. Rhonda Buckner is the administrative assistant for the Department of Pediatrics Academic Affairs Office.
